Antimicrobial Potentials of Eclipta Alba by Well Diffusion Method
The susceptibility of nine microbial species to an antimicrobial extract from Eclipta alba was screened using the well diffusion assay. Three different volumes (24, 30 and 36 μl/well) were tested. Analysis of the data revealed that all extracts from Eclipta alba showed antimicrobial activities. An N-butanol fraction showed inhibitory activities against all nine microbial species. متن کاملUV protection and self-cleaning finish for cotton fabric using metal oxide nanoparticles
Ultra-violet protection and self-cleaning action of nano zinc oxide (ZnO) and titanium di-oxide (TiO2) with acrylic binder has been assessed on the cotton fabric using pad-dry-cure method. Different precursors, such as zinc acetate and titanium tetrachloride have been used to synthesize nanoparticles.
